First round: i dunno name (playing a mirari's wake deck)

Mirari's wake decks rely on Mirari's Wake to generate degenerate amounts of mana to do dastardly things with it. This particular deck used it to create a bunch of centaurs with Centaur Glade, or gain a bunch of life with Stream of Life and Life Burst and win with Test of Endurance. Unfortunately for him, I had AEther Burst for his centaurs, and Squirrel Nest so i could always bounce back from Wrath of God. In the second game, I sided in 3 Naturalize and took out 2 Careful Study and Krosan Colossus. We ran out of time so the second game was a draw.

round 3: (didn't get his name) (playing mono-red burn with ensnaring bridge)

i lost the first game. he had ensnaring bridge out and no cards in hand and a patchwork gnomes in play. I had squirrel nest and was holding aether burst. he had 6 life, and i had 5 squirrels. i needed to make one more squirrel and aether burst his gnomes so he would have one card in hand, then i could kill him with 1 power things. unfortunately, he drew chain of plasma, then killed me with that and 3 barbarian rings (i had 8 life). the next game i sided out krosan colossus, roar of the wurm, 2 arrogant wurm, 3 deep analysis, 1 careful study and sided in 3 naturalize, 3 grip of amnesia, 2 phantom centaur. i won the second game because i circular logiced one ensnaring bridge and naturalized the other and attacked with phantom centaur. i won the third game because he was stuck with two molten influences in his hand (red counterspell), and i didn't cast anything for him to counter, so i could attack with wild mongrel through his ensnaring bridge
